NNN REIT Achieves 35 Years of Dividend Increases

NNN REIT has marked a significant accomplishment with its 35th consecutive annual dividend increase, positioning itself among an elite group of companies. This accomplishment highlights the stability and reliability of NNN REIT's investment strategy, appealing for income-focused investors.

NNN REIT's consistent ability to increase its dividends showcases the company's financial health and stability, which is particularly attractive to income-focused investors. This milestone places NNN REIT in an elite category, with only two other REITs and fewer than 80 publicly traded companies maintaining a similar dividend-hiking streak.

The recent 3% increase in its dividend has not only helped the trust's yield approach 5%, but it also establishes a considerable differential above the S&P 500's average yield of under 1.5%. This competitive positioning enhances NNN REIT's profile as a desirable option for dividend-seeking investors.

Additionally, NNN REIT maintains a conservative payout ratio of around 70% based on its adjusted funds from operations (FFO) estimate of $3.31 to $3.37 per share, which provides a buffer for future dividend growth and financial stability. The company's strong investment-grade balance sheet also affords it further financial flexibility.

In terms of growth strategies, NNN REIT leverages rent increases and property acquisitions, with its leases typically containing escalation clauses that allow for moderate annual rent increases. The investment volume has been significant, averaging over $800 million in the past two years, underpinned by strategic relationships with existing tenants.

The potential for future growth is bolstered by current acquisition strategies and capital recycling practices which could lead to increased cash flow and continued dividend increases. Selling properties for gains demonstrates proactive financial management and resource allocation.

Overall, NNN REIT's positioning as an elite dividend stock with a stable portfolio and excellent financials creates a favorable outlook for continued dividend growth, making it an attractive investment for long-term income generation.
